American Honda Motor Co., Inc.
Models: Honda CR-V, 2002-2004
Number Potentially Involved: Â Â 130,617
Dates of Manufacture:   April 2002 â€' April 2004
Defect:   On certain sport utility vehicles, the wiring harness of the driver’s front air bag was incorrectly wired. In the event of a crash, the air bag inflation rate will be incorrect, which could increase the risk of injury.
Remedy: Â Â Dealers will repair the wiring. The manufacturer has reported that owner notification is expected to begin during July 2004. Owners may contact Honda at 1-800-999-1009.
NHTSA Recall No.: 04V255
Honda Recall No.: P34
